The disabled alarm wiring diagram typically includes information on the power supply, control panel, sensors, sirens, and other components of the alarm system. Each of these components plays a crucial role in the overall functionality of the alarm system, and the wiring diagram provides a clear overview of how they are interconnected.
One of the most important components of the disabled alarm system is the control panel. This is where the system is armed and disarmed, and where alerts are triggered in the event of an intrusion. The wiring diagram provides information on how the control panel is connected to the power supply, sensors, and sirens. By studying this part of the diagram, technicians can troubleshoot issues related to the control panel and ensure that it is functioning properly.
Another key component of the disabled alarm system is the sensors. These devices are strategically placed around the premises to detect any unauthorized entry or movement. The wiring diagram outlines how the sensors are connected to the control panel and power supply. By understanding this part of the diagram, technicians can identify any faulty sensors and replace them as needed.
The sirens are another crucial component of the disabled alarm system. These devices are designed to emit a loud sound in the event of an intrusion, alerting the occupants of the premises and potentially deterring the intruder. The wiring diagram shows how the sirens are connected to the control panel and power supply. Technicians can use this information to troubleshoot any issues with the sirens and ensure they are functioning correctly.
